Solid wood!
Hard to find any flat-package furniture that is not made of manufactured materials. The result is furniture that looks like it belongs in the home permanently. Assembly is as simple as it can be, which is not to say that it's easy. All the parts are labeled for each step, and the parts fit together very well. There's even a bag of "extra parts" in case you lose something. You really need two people and plenty of time to do the installation, but when you are finished (and if you don't skip reading any part of the well-documented instructions) you will have an elegant well-working Lori bed (not just a murphy-bed). No Ikea flat-package I've ever assembled takes more time and careful attention. What you get: The design is robust, clever and seems to be durable. This unit enables us to convert a small room in a small apartment to a guest room easily. Thanks to the desk option, someone can also take a meeting in that room when the unit is closed. It was a perfect solution for us. We also bought the mattress. Raised in the 70's, I never saw a mattress delivered in a roll vacuum packed. We are very impressed that it's just like a true springform mattress, not some foam thing. It really is precisely weighted to match the gas cylinder, as advertised. If you buy your own mattress instead, weight matters: slightly lighter is better than slightly heavier than the "perfect" matching weight. A quick note about the packaging. You never saw anything packaged as well as this product. Whoever designed and produces this product really cares. Ironically some of the PACKING material Lori uses to protect the components is actually MDF like you might find as a working part of lesser bed kits.
